- void track()
- {
- while(true)
- {
- s1 = analogRead(0);
- s2 = analogRead(1);
- s3 = analogRead(2);
- if(s1 >= 512 && s2 >= 512)
- {
- fd2(65*0.99,65);
- }
- else if(s1 <= 512 && s2 >= 512)
- {
- fd2(speed*var,speed/3);
- }
- else if(s1 >= 512 && s2 <= 512)
- {
- fd2(speed*var/3,speed);
- }
- if(s3 < 440)
- {
- break;
- }
- }
- check();
- }
- void check()
- {
- while(true)
- {
- s1 = analogRead(0);
- s2 = analogRead(1);
- s3 = analogRead(2);
- if(s1 >= 512 && s2 >= 512)
- {
- fd2(speed*var/2,speed/2);
- }
- else if(s1 >= 512 && s2 <= 512)
- {
- fd2(speed*var*2.18/2,speed/2.5);
- }
- else if(s1 <= 512 && s2 >= 512)
- {
- fd2(speed*var/2.5,speed*2.18/2);
- }
- else
- {
- break;
- }
- }
- }
